CVE-2026-28778
Hardcoded FTP Credentials and LPE(via Insecure Permissions) for `xd` Local Account on IDC SFX2100
Description

International Datacasting Corporation (IDC) SFX Series SuperFlex Satellite Receiver contains undocumented, hardcoded/insecure credentials for the `xd` user account. A remote unauthenticated attacker can log in via FTP using these credentials. Because the `xd` user has write permissions to their home directory where root-executed binaries and symlinks (such as those invoked by `xdstartstop`) are stored, the attacker can overwrite these files or manipulate symlinks to achieve arbitrary code execution as the root user.

Solution
Remove or disable undocumented credentials and change default passwords.
  • Disable or remove the 'xd' user account.
  • Change all hardcoded credentials.
  • Implement secure password policies.
  • Remove or secure writable directories.
